Core Vaccines Every Dog Must Have
To keep your pet healthy and balanced and risk-free, it's necessary to ensure they obtain core inoculations. These vaccinations shield against serious conditions that can be dangerous.
The core injections include rabies, distemper, parvovirus, and adenovirus. Rabies is mandatory in several areas due to its fatal nature and transmission to human beings. Distemper and parvovirus are very infectious, affecting young and unvaccinated canines drastically. Adenovirus, which creates transmittable hepatitis, can likewise bring about significant health and wellness problems.
Normally, your vet will recommend a vaccination routine, starting early in your dog's life. Maintaining your pet dog updated on these core injections not only safeguards their health however likewise assists secure other pets they communicate with, making it crucial for boarding and interacting socially.
Bordetella: The Kennel Coughing Injection
Exactly how can you guarantee your canine remains safe and healthy while boarding? One crucial action is getting the Bordetella injection, which protects versus kennel coughing. This very transmittable breathing infection spreads rapidly in position where pets collect, like boarding centers.
Even if your pet dog seems healthy and balanced, they can still bring and send the infection. Most boarding centers require proof of this injection, so it's essential to arrange it ahead of time.
The vaccine is typically provided as a nasal spray or shot, and it's effective for about 6 months to a year. Maintaining your dog vaccinated not just safeguards their health and wellness but likewise helps maintain a healthy atmosphere for all family pets in the boarding facility.

Pooch Parvovirus: A Serious Danger
Canine parvovirus presents a major danger to pet dogs, specifically in boarding settings where exposure to other pets prevails. This highly contagious virus can result in extreme intestinal concerns, dehydration, and even death otherwise dealt with quickly.
Signs and symptoms frequently consist of throwing up, looseness of the bowels, lethargy, and loss of appetite. Because the virus spreads out with direct contact with infected pet dogs or contaminated surface areas, it's critical to ensure your canine is immunized prior to boarding.
The parvovirus injection is generally given up a series of shots, beginning as early as 6 weeks old. Maintaining your pet dog updated on vaccinations not just safeguards them however additionally aids protect other animals in the boarding center.

Rabies Vaccination Needs
When preparing to board your dog, it's vital to understand rabies inoculation requirements, as most centers mandate evidence of this vaccination.
Rabies is a severe viral disease that can be deadly to both animals and humans, making it a leading priority for boarding centers. Usually, pet dogs have to obtain their rabies vaccination at the very least thirty day prior to boarding, and the vaccination needs to continue to be present throughout their stay.
You'll require to provide paperwork from a qualified vet, revealing that your pet dog depends on date on their rabies inoculation.
Remember that some states have certain laws pertaining to rabies inoculations, so it's smart to examine neighborhood policies also.
Ensuring your pet fulfills these needs will help maintain them risk-free during their keep.
Leptospirosis: A Boosting Worry
After ensuring your canine meets rabies vaccination requirements, it is necessary to consider various other vaccinations, specifically for leptospirosis.
This microbial illness is spread out with contaminated water and can lead to major health issues, consisting of kidney damage. Leptospirosis is ending up being extra typical, especially in areas with a high populace of wild animals and throughout wet weather when standing water prevails.
If your dog frequents boarding facilities, parks, or doggy day care, they're at higher threat of exposure. Inoculation against leptospirosis can be crucial in safeguarding your fuzzy close friend, as very early signs and symptoms can be refined and quickly neglected.
Speak to your vet about whether the leptospirosis vaccination appropriates for your canine, specifically if they'll remain in atmospheres where the condition is a concern.
Added Vaccines Based on Lifestyle
How do you understand which injections your canine actually needs? All of it comes down to your canine's way of living and direct exposure dangers.
If your dog loves socializing at dog parks or boarding facilities, consider the Bordetella vaccine to secure versus kennel cough.
For those that frequently hike or stroll in wooded areas, the Lyme illness vaccine could be necessary, especially in regions with high tick populaces.
If your dog delights in playdates with other pet dogs, think about the canine influenza vaccination for included safety and security.
Every pet dog's requirements differ, so reviewing your pet dog's habits with your vet can assist you identify the best inoculation strategy.
Tailoring vaccinations to your pet dog's way of life ensures they stay healthy and shielded from avoidable illness.
Timing Your Canine's Inoculation
While intending your pet's inoculations, it's essential to consider their age, wellness status, and way of life.
Young puppies normally start their inoculations around 6 to 8 weeks old, with boosters offered every 3 to four weeks till they're about 4 months old.
If your canine is older, ensure they're current on their chance ats least two weeks before boarding. This timing permits their body immune system to construct appropriate security.
If your pet dog has any wellness problems, consult your veterinarian for a customized inoculation timetable.

Getting ready for the Boarding Center's Demands
Before you head to the boarding facility, it's important to recognize their certain vaccination and health and wellness demands. Each facility might have various regulations, so examine their web site or give them a phone call.
Most areas will need up-to-date vaccinations, including rabies, DHPP, and Bordetella. You'll wish to collect your pet's inoculation records and ensure they're current. If your pet dog hasn't obtained a particular vaccine, timetable a consultation with your vet as soon as possible.
Furthermore, some centers might require a current checkup or flea and tick avoidance. Preparing ahead of time will certainly make the process smoother and ensure your dog has a risk-free and satisfying remain.
